Finding Today's Baseball Game Schedule
Finding an accurate and up-to-date schedule of baseball games today is the first step to planning your viewing. The good news is that there are numerous resources available to help you stay informed. Let's explore some of the most reliable options:
- Official League Websites: The official websites of leagues like MLB, Minor League Baseball (MiLB), and college baseball conferences are your primary sources for game schedules. These websites provide comprehensive listings, including game times, locations, and broadcast information. For example, MLB.com offers a detailed schedule with filters for date, team, and broadcast channel. You can easily navigate to the specific day you're interested in and see all the games scheduled. These official sites are meticulously maintained, ensuring accuracy and providing the most up-to-date information, including any last-minute changes or postponements. They also often include links to purchase tickets and access live game streams.
- Sports News Websites and Apps: Reputable sports news websites and apps like ESPN, Bleacher Report, and The Score offer comprehensive sports schedules, including baseball games. These platforms often provide additional features, such as live scores, game highlights, and news articles, making them a valuable resource for staying connected to the sport. ESPN, for instance, has a dedicated baseball section with a daily schedule, live scores, and in-depth analysis. Bleacher Report often includes fan perspectives and social media buzz around games, while The Score offers customizable notifications to keep you updated on your favorite teams. These platforms are designed to provide a seamless experience, allowing you to quickly find the information you need and stay engaged with the games.
- Team Websites and Social Media: If you're a fan of a specific team, their official website and social media accounts (Twitter, Facebook, Instagram) are excellent sources for game schedules and updates. Teams often announce game times, broadcast details, and any schedule changes on these platforms. Following your favorite team on social media can also provide you with insights into team news, player updates, and fan engagement opportunities. Many teams use their websites and social media to connect directly with their fans, creating a sense of community and providing exclusive content. So, whether you're looking for the most recent schedule updates or behind-the-scenes glimpses of your team, these channels are invaluable resources.

How to Watch Baseball Games Today
Once you've identified the baseball games today you want to watch, the next step is figuring out how to access them. Fortunately, there are numerous ways to watch baseball, catering to different preferences and viewing habits. Let's explore the various options:
- Television Broadcasts: Traditional television broadcasts remain a popular way to watch baseball games. National networks like ESPN, Fox, and TBS often broadcast MLB games, including regular season matchups, playoffs, and the World Series. Regional sports networks (RSNs) provide coverage of local teams, offering a more focused and in-depth viewing experience. For example, if you're a fan of the New York Yankees, you can watch their games on YES Network, while fans of the Los Angeles Dodgers can tune into Spectrum SportsNet LA. RSNs often provide pre- and post-game shows, as well as analysis and interviews, offering a comprehensive viewing experience for local fans. To find out which games are being broadcast on television, consult the game schedule on official league websites or sports news platforms. You can also check your local listings for RSN broadcasts. The reliability and familiarity of television broadcasts make them a convenient option for many baseball fans.
- Streaming Services: Streaming services have revolutionized the way we consume sports, and baseball is no exception. MLB.TV is the official streaming service of Major League Baseball, offering live and on-demand access to nearly every MLB game. This service is a fantastic option for fans who want to follow multiple teams or who live outside their favorite team's broadcast area. Other streaming services, such as ESPN+, Peacock, and Apple TV+, also offer live baseball games, often as part of broader sports packages. For instance, ESPN+ carries a selection of MLB games, as well as college baseball and international baseball events. Peacock streams select MLB games on Sundays, while Apple TV+ has a weekly "Friday Night Baseball" broadcast. The flexibility and accessibility of streaming services make them an attractive option for modern baseball fans. You can watch games on your computer, tablet, smartphone, or smart TV, allowing you to enjoy the action wherever you are.

Key Matchups and Players to Watch in Baseball Games Today
Beyond simply knowing the schedule and how to watch, understanding the key matchups and players to watch can enhance your enjoyment of baseball games today. Here are some factors to consider:
- Pitching Matchups: In baseball, the starting pitchers often dictate the flow of the game. Analyzing the pitching matchup – the two starting pitchers facing off against each other – is crucial for predicting the potential outcome of a game. Consider factors like the pitchers' recent performance, their career statistics against the opposing team, and their pitching styles. A matchup between two dominant pitchers, for example, might suggest a low-scoring, tightly contested game, while a matchup between a veteran ace and a young, inexperienced pitcher could create an opportunity for an upset. Some resources, like Baseball-Reference and Fangraphs, provide in-depth statistics and analysis of pitching matchups, allowing you to make informed predictions. Paying attention to the pitchers' strengths and weaknesses can provide valuable insights into the game's dynamics.
- Team Rivalries: Some of the most exciting baseball games today involve intense rivalries between teams. These games often carry extra significance, as teams battle for bragging rights and playoff positioning. Classic rivalries like the New York Yankees vs. the Boston Red Sox, the Los Angeles Dodgers vs. the San Francisco Giants, and the Chicago Cubs vs. the St. Louis Cardinals are known for their passionate fan bases and dramatic moments. Rivalry games often have a different feel than regular season matchups, with heightened intensity and a playoff-like atmosphere. The players often bring extra energy and focus to these games, creating a compelling spectacle for fans. Understanding the history and dynamics of these rivalries can add another layer of excitement to your viewing experience.
- Star Players: Every baseball team has its star players – the ones who can change the course of a game with their hitting, pitching, or fielding prowess. Keep an eye on these players, as their performance can have a significant impact on the outcome of the game. Players like Shohei Ohtani, Mike Trout, and Aaron Judge are known for their exceptional talent and ability to deliver clutch performances. Following these star players and understanding their strengths and weaknesses can make watching baseball games today even more engaging. Sports news websites and apps often provide updates and analysis of star players, allowing you to stay informed about their performance and potential impact on the game.

Other Factors that Influence Baseball Games
Beyond the key matchups and players, several other factors can influence the outcome and enjoyment of baseball games today. These elements add complexity and intrigue to the sport, making each game a unique and unpredictable event. Let's delve into some of these factors:
- Weather Conditions: Weather plays a significant role in baseball, affecting everything from the ball's flight to the players' performance. Rain can lead to game delays or postponements, while wind can alter the trajectory of batted balls. Hot weather can fatigue players, while cold weather can make it difficult to grip the ball. Teams often adjust their strategies based on weather conditions. For example, a windy day might lead to more fly balls and home runs, while a rainy day might favor the team with the stronger pitching staff. Checking the weather forecast before a game can provide valuable insights into the potential dynamics of the matchup. Some websites and apps provide detailed weather information specifically tailored to baseball games, including wind speed, temperature, and precipitation probabilities. Understanding how weather can impact the game adds another layer of analysis to your viewing experience.
- Ballpark Dimensions: The dimensions of a baseball field can vary significantly from ballpark to ballpark, influencing the type of game that is played. Some ballparks have short fences, which can lead to more home runs, while others have deep outfields, which can make it more difficult to score. Fenway Park in Boston, for example, is known for its iconic "Green Monster," a tall left-field wall that can turn would-be home runs into singles. Coors Field in Denver, with its high altitude, tends to favor hitters due to the thinner air. These variations in ballpark dimensions can affect team strategies and player performance. Understanding the dimensions of the ballpark where a game is being played can provide context for the game's flow and potential outcomes. Commentators often discuss ballpark dimensions during broadcasts, highlighting how they might influence the game.
- Injuries and Lineup Changes: Injuries are an unfortunate reality in baseball, and they can significantly impact a team's performance. Key injuries can force teams to make lineup changes, which can affect their offensive and defensive capabilities. A team's depth and ability to overcome injuries are often indicators of their overall strength. Monitoring injury reports and lineup announcements before a game can provide insights into potential weaknesses and strengths. Sports news websites and apps provide up-to-date information on injuries and lineup changes, allowing you to stay informed about these crucial factors. Understanding how injuries and lineup changes can impact a game can enhance your appreciation for the strategic decisions made by managers and coaches.
